The University of Texas at Dallas' premier Naveen Jindal School of Management offers students unable to attend a resident MBA program an identical core curriculum in its Professional MBA Online Program (PMBA). Uniquely, the PMBA has no requirement for students to attend campus at any point during the program, and students are not organized into specifically structured classes, but complete a part-time course load entirely at their own pace. All of this makes JSOM's online MBA ideal for professional students who prioritize a "good balance of convenience, reputation, and price." Even considering all this, students don't feel distant from the program: "I feel like my entire program is tailored to me individually. The staff is always around to solve any issues and to offer advice." Students also like the convenience of the "multi-platform" learning technology and note that the school is "progressing each year in how they use it to teach and foster discussion." The Online MBA available through the University of Denver’s Daniels College of Business offers “a flexible schedule, reasonable price,…and a GMAT waiver,” allowing working professionals the ability to earn a degree in as little as 21 months (with the option of four start dates a year). The 60-credit curriculum is based in one of four concentrations, providing the “right balance of independent study and interaction with peers” thanks to a blend of online courses, self-paced learning, and interactive experiences (which includes two in-person domestic or global immersion s). Faculty “are very engaged with their materials and well-connected to the synchronous and asynchronous coursework” and “have been easy to contact and are always willing to help or engage in further discussion if you ask.” The amount of “face-to-face class time is reasonable,” there “are multiple evening times (early evening and later evening) to accommodate those in the Pacific time zone,” and the teamwork and participation requirements “force you to get out of your comfort zone.”

At the University of Utah's David Eccles School of Business, MBA Online students share the same "phenomenal" and "supportive" professors as their on-campus counterparts, but benefit from the "convenience" and "accessibility" of an entirely online format. Students choose the University of Utah for its "great reputation" and "cutting-edge" outlook. When they arrive, they love how "the program is run extremely effectively" and that the "administration is always responsive and accommodating." One student remarks, "My e-mails are answered within one hour, even at 2 a.m." Members of the program all attend a three-day on-campus residency during their first year, which students say is "fantastic." "There was a perfect mix of lectures, group work, mixers, and time to get to know our instructors." MBA Online's major strengths are "the quality and accessibility of the instructors and the tools and assignments used to create a collaborative environment." Santa Clara University’s Leavey School of Business has offered a well-respected physical MBA in the San Francisco Bay Area for decades, and according to students, their new online MBA program has come strongly out of the gate. There’s a quarterly online program that’s all about flexibility, on account of “being online without any set class schedules,” and while the work remains rigorous and demanding, particularly for those already working jobs or raising families, enrollees boast of the time-management skills they’ve picked up along the way, and stress that because you can “take as many classes as you’re willing to handle” and that “extensions [on assignments are] typically … granted by professors upon request, so it’s fairly doable to maintain a work-life balance.”

Some students note that a few bugs are still being worked out in the rollout of the online MBA program, and that not all professors are as equally adept at utilizing the environment’s message boards and video lectures.
